ambitious翻译
adj.
有雄心的;有野心的;费力的;耗资的
双语释义
adj.(形容词)有野心的;有雄心的determined to be successful, rich, powerful, etc.;having a strong desire for success, power, wealth, etc.费力的;耗资的;耗时的needing a lot of effort, money or time to succeed;showing or resulting from a desire to do sth difficult or sth that demands great effort, great skill, etc.
英英释义
ambitious[ æm'biʃəs ]
adj.having a strong desire for success or achievementrequiring full use of your abilities or resources
"ambitious schedule"
同义词:challenging
ambitious用法
词汇搭配
用作形容词 (adj.)~+名词ambitious aim雄心勃勃的目标ambitious boy野心勃勃的男孩ambitious design大胆的设计ambitious man有野心的人ambitious politician有野心的政客ambitious lawyer雄心勃勃的律师ambitious youth有抱负的青年副词+~very ambitious很有志向~+介词be ambitious after wealth渴望财富be ambitious for sth对…有野心的,渴望得到某物be ambitious for one's children望子成龙be ambitious for power渴望获得权力be ambitious for social position极欲获得社会地位be ambitious of sth对…有野心的,渴望得到某物be ambitious of distinction期望成名be ambitious of love渴望得到爱be ambitious of success渴望成功
双语例句
用作形容词(adj.)Mr. Lin is an ambitious businessman.
林先生是个有雄心的生意人。I ought to do something a bit more ambitious.
我应当做些更有雄心的事。They ventured on an ambitious program of reform.
他们冒然采取一项野心勃勃的改革计划。The ambitious boy learned very quickly.
那位有抱负的少年学得很快。Only ambitious students get the best marks.
有抱负的学生才能取得最好的成绩。
